Push inserts a value onto the top of the stack.
Pop extracts the top value from the stack.
These are the two primary operations that can be performed upon a stack. Prior to popping a value, you will first check the stack is not empty, store the top value, then pop the stack. For a stack of type T, you might use the following:
if (!stack.empty()) {
T value {stack.top()}; // copy top value
stack.pop(); // remove value from stack
// use value...
}
insert an item in data structure is known as a push operation....
push an element is stack means we are inserting an element into stack.
Stacks
Merging is combining the records in two different file into a single file.
types of data structure types of data structure
How do you amend a data structure?
difference between serch data structure and allocation data structure
Stacks
Merging is combining the records in two different file into a single file.
typedef struct ListElement {struct ListElement *next;long data;} ListElement;
Push and pop are properties of a stack (also called a LIFO-- Last In, First Out-- queue).
types of data structure types of data structure
How do you amend a data structure?
Circular queue is a linear data structure that follows the First In First Out principle. A re-buffering problem often occurs for each dequeue operation in a standard queue data structure. This is solved by using a circular queue which joins the front and rear ends of a queue.
there are two operations you can do with a STACK one is PUSH operation and the other is POP operation
collection of dissimilar type of data is called non homogeneous data structure as for example structure .
difference between serch data structure and allocation data structure
weakness of data structure diagrams
in homogeneous data structure all the elements of same data types known as homogeneous data structure. example:- array